description |
This paper delves into the multifaceted landscape of Human-Computer Interface (HCI) design, meticulously exploring the foundational theories and cutting-edge paradigms that form the backbone of the digital user experience. It skillfully synthesizes profound insights gleaned from seminal works, including Norman's cognitive model and Fitts' law, as well as delving into socio-technical theories such as Activity Theory and Distributed Cognition. These collective theories illuminate the intricate tapestry of human cognition, motor control, and the dynamic interactions between individuals, technology, and their environment. Furthermore, this paper rigorously analyzes the frontiers of HCI through emerging paradigms like natural user interfaces and affective computing, underlining the paramount importance of user-centered design principles in fostering empathy, inclusivity, and accessibility. By comprehensively exploring and elucidating the theoretical foundations of HCI, this work aspires to invigorate innovative, user-centric design approaches, thus enriching the future of human-computer interactions and enhancing the overall user experience within the digital realm. |
